Kimberly Hamilton-Wims, Ph.D., is an experienced environmental scientist with a robust background in both academic and practical applications of chemistry. Currently serving as an Environmental Scientist Manager at the Louisiana Department of Environmental Quality since September 2016, Kimberly has also held roles as Environmental Scientist Supervisor and Environmental Scientist within the same organization. Previous experience includes teaching faculty positions at Northwest Mississippi Community College from August 2003 to September 2016, and various laboratory technician roles at organizations such as Honeywell, Syngenta, Entek Environmental Laboratory, and an internship with the North Central Texas Council of Governments. Kimberly earned a Ph.D. in Chemistry from Louisiana State University and a Bachelor's degree in Chemistry from Southern University and Agricultural and Mechanical College at Baton Rouge.

Louisiana Department of Environmental Quality
The mission of the Louisiana Department of Environmental Quality is to provide service to the people of Louisiana through comprehensive environmental protection in order to promote and protect health, safety and welfare while considering sound policies that are consistent with statutory mandates. The department is divided into the following offices: The Office of the Secretary The Office of Management and Finance The Office of Environmental Services The Office of Environmental Compliance The Office of Environmental Assessment
